Why Fertility Isn’t Just a Game of Chance
It’s tempting to think of fertility as a simple roll of the dice, but the reality is more like a high-stakes poker game where you need to know when to hold ’em and when to fold ’em. Age, health, lifestyle, and genetics all play their part, and ignoring these factors is like betting blindfolded. For example, female fertility tends to decline after the age of 35, which is less a myth and more a statistical fact that no amount of wishful thinking can overturn.
Common Misconceptions That Can Cost You
Many people believe that fertility issues are rare or only affect certain “types” of people. The truth is, fertility challenges can be as unpredictable as a roulette wheel. Here are some misconceptions that deserve a skeptical eyebrow:
- Fertility is always a woman’s issue: Men contribute to about half of all fertility problems, yet this fact often gets lost in the shuffle.
- Stress is the main culprit: While stress can impact your body, it’s rarely the sole reason for fertility struggles.
- Fertility treatments guarantee success: These are medical interventions, not magic tricks. They improve odds but don’t promise a win every time.
Tracking Fertility: Tools and Techniques
Trying to conceive without tracking your fertility is like playing blackjack without knowing the value of your cards. Fortunately, modern technology offers a variety of tools that can help you read the table better. From ovulation predictor kits to basal body temperature charts and fertility apps, these methods provide clues about your most fertile days.
| Method | Accuracy | Cost | User-Friendliness |
|---|---|---|---|
| Ovulation Predictor Kits (OPKs) | High | Moderate | Easy |
| Basal Body Temperature (BBT) Charting | Moderate | Low | Requires diligence |
| Fertility Apps | Variable | Free to moderate | Very easy |
Why Tracking Alone Isn’t a Sure Bet
Even with the best tracking tools, fertility can still be as unpredictable as a craps table. Timing intercourse around ovulation increases the odds, but it doesn’t guarantee a win. Biological factors beyond your control can throw a wrench in the works, reminding us that sometimes, the house has the edge no matter how well you play.
When to Call in the Professionals
If you’ve been playing the fertility game for a while without seeing any chips in your pile, it might be time to consult a specialist. Fertility clinics and reproductive endocrinologists can offer diagnostic tests and treatments that go beyond home strategies. Think of them as the pit bosses who can spot the subtle tells and help you adjust your strategy.
However, it’s important to approach this step with a clear head. Not every treatment is suitable for everyone, and some come with their own risks and costs. A thorough evaluation and honest conversation about expectations are essential before diving into medical interventions.
Questions to Ask Your Fertility Specialist
- What tests do you recommend and why?
- What are the success rates for my age and condition?
- What are the potential risks and side effects of treatments?
- How long should I try treatments before considering other options?
- Are there lifestyle changes I should make to improve my chances?
